*The Culture of China: An Introduction for Beginners* offers a comprehensive and accessible journey into one of the world's oldest and most dynamic civilizations. This book delves into the foundational philosophies of Confucianism, Taoism, and Buddhism, revealing how these systems have interwoven to shape Chinese thought, social structures, and ethics for millennia. Readers will explore the paramount importance of the family unit and filial piety, the historical intricacies of social hierarchy, and the pervasive influence of *guanxi* (personal networks) in daily life, providing essential context for understanding Chinese interpersonal dynamics.
Beyond its philosophical and social underpinnings, this introduction illuminates the vibrant tapestry of Chinese cultural expression. From the nuances of its diverse language and the esteemed art of calligraphy to the rich array of regional cuisines and the profound traditions of tea culture, the book paints a vivid picture of Chinese life. It also guides readers through the elaborate rituals of its most significant festivals, including the joyous Chinese New Year, the contemplative Mid-Autumn and Qingming festivals, and the spirited Dragon Boat Festival, showcasing how these celebrations reinforce community bonds and historical narratives. The chapters further explore traditional Chinese opera, literature, painting, sculpture, and the discipline of martial arts, demonstrating how these art forms embody deeply held philosophical ideals and historical consciousness.
Ultimately, *The Culture of China* reveals a civilization defined by remarkable continuity, adaptability, and an ongoing dialogue between its ancient past and its rapidly modernizing present. It examines how traditional values persist amidst technological advancement and globalization, and highlights the rich diversity of contemporary Chinese culture, encompassing regional customs and ethnic traditions. This book is an invaluable resource for anyone seeking to understand the enduring elements and evolving complexities of Chinese identity, offering a nuanced and appreciative perspective on its profound cultural heritage.
